WHAT IS FROZEN SHOULDER?

FROZEN SHOULDER, or ADHESIVE CAPSULITIS, is a painful and progressive condition where the shoulder capsule becomes inflamed, thickened, and stiff, severely limiting range of motion. It typically affects adults between 40–60 years, especially women and individuals with diabetes or thyroid disorders 

STAGES OF FROZEN SHOULDER:

  • FREEZING: Increasing pain and stiffness (6–9 months)
  • FROZEN: Reduced pain but severe immobility (4–6 months)
  • THAWING: Gradual return of motion (6 months–2 years)
